What is a relocation package for data science jobs?

A relocation package for data science jobs is a set of benefits provided by employers to help new hires move to a new location for work. These packages typically cover expenses such as moving costs, temporary housing, travel expenses, and sometimes assistance with finding permanent housing. The goal is to reduce the financial and logistical burden of relocating so that data scientists can start their new roles smoothly. The specifics of a relocation package can vary widely between companies, locations, and job levels.

How does a typical relocation package support data science professionals moving to a new city or country for a role?

A typical relocation package for data science professionals often includes assistance with moving expenses, temporary housing, and support with visa or work permit processes. You may also receive help with finding permanent accommodation and settling-in services, such as local orientation or language courses. These benefits are designed to ease the transition so you can focus on your new role, collaborate effectively with your team, and integrate quickly into the organization. Relocation packages vary by company, so it's a good idea to clarify the details during the hiring process.

Job description


We are seeking an experienced Senior Data Scientist to be a core individual contributor within the Personal Finance portfolio, one of the fastest-growing areas of the business. You will own analysis, measurement, and modeling that shape how we grow transactions, improve the member shopping experience, and expand top-of-funnel signals across a Personal Finance vertical.


This is a high-ownership individual contributor role. You will work directly with vertical, product, and marketing leaders to frame problems, run experiments, and translate findings into decisions. The ideal candidate combines strong technical depth with business judgment and the ability to influence partners without formal authority.


Responsibilities


Own the analytics and measurement roadmap for your vertical, translating business goals into a prioritized plan. 


Design, run, and read experiments to grow transactions and improve conversion, using rigorous measurement to validate what works. 

Build models and analyses for ranking, targeting, personalization, and top-of-funnel signal expansion that drive member and business outcomes. 


Conduct funnel, conversion, and incrementality analysis to identify the biggest opportunities and size their impact. 


Partner directly with Product, Marketing, and AI Science to embed data-driven decisions into the member experience and end-to-end journeys. 


Develop the key success metrics and leading indicators that show how the vertical is performing and whether each initiative is delivering the desired outcomes. 


Use Generative AI tools (for example, Claude) to accelerate analytical workflows and scale your impact. 


Communicate insights clearly to partners at all levels, turning complex analysis into concise, actionable recommendations. 


Collaborate across data science and data engineering to build durable datasets and analytics capabilities.


Qualifications


Minimum 4 or more years of experience in analytics or data science. 


Strong hands-on foundation in SQL and data visualization tools such as Tableau or Looker. 


Experience applying advanced analytics and machine learning techniques (for example, Python, ML models, experimentation, LLMs)  to real business problems. 


Proven ability to design and interpret experiments and to measure incremental impact. 


Ability to build analytical frameworks for ambiguous problems and to drive them to a decision. 


Strong communication skills and the ability to influence product and business partners without formal authority. 

Bachelor's or Master's degree in Statistics, Mathematics, Computer Science, Economics, or a related field. 


Experience in fintech or financial services is a plus.
